In Christ and In Colossae: Colossians 1:1-2
from In the Margins with Shannon TL Kearns · host Shannon TL Kearns
Summary In this episode, Father Shannon Kearns explores the book of Colossians and the power of written communication. He reflects on his own experiences with letters and the importance of connection and understanding. Kearns emphasizes the need to engage with the Bible and grapple with its complexities, acknowledging both the harm and inspiration it can bring. He delves into the context of the book of Colossians and the questions it raises about identity and allegiance. Ultimately, Kearns encourages listeners to wrestle with their faith and live out their beliefs in the world. Takeaways Written communication, such as letters, can provide a sense of connection and understanding.Engaging with the Bible requires grappling with its complexities and considering its historical context.The book of Colossians raises questions about identity and allegiance in relation to faith.Living in Christ means navigating the tension between the values of the world and the values of the Christian community.
